Alternatives to Amsterdam Font for Designers

1. Open Sans

Open Sans is a clean and modern sans-serif font designed by Steve Matteson. It is a versatile font suitable for body text and headings. Use Open Sans for digital products, websites, and applications where a clean and minimalistic design is required.

Open Sans compares to Amsterdam Font in terms of its clean and modern aesthetic, but it has a more neutral and versatile feel. While Amsterdam Font has a unique, handwritten quality, Open Sans is more straightforward and suitable for a wider range of design applications.

2. Lato

Lato is a sans-serif font designed by Łukasz Dziedzic. It has a modern and elegant feel, making it suitable for headings and titles. Use Lato for designs that require a touch of sophistication and elegance, such as luxury brands or high-end websites.

Lato compares to Amsterdam Font in terms of its modern and elegant feel, but it has a more refined and sophisticated aesthetic. While Amsterdam Font has a more playful and handwritten quality, Lato is more suited for designs that require a touch of sophistication.

3. Montserrat

Montserrrat is a sans-serif font designed by Julieta Ulanovsky. It has a geometric and urban feel, making it suitable for titles and headings. Use Montserrat for designs that require a strong and modern aesthetic, such as urban or industrial-themed designs.

Montserrat compares to Amsterdam Font in terms of its modern and urban feel, but it has a more geometric and structured aesthetic. While Amsterdam Font has a more playful and handwritten quality, Montserrat is more suited for designs that require a strong and modern feel.

How do I install and activate the Amsterdam Font on my computer?

To install the Amsterdam Font, simply download the font files from the official website or a font repository and extract them to a folder on your computer. Then, follow these steps to activate the font:

1. Open the Font Book application on your Mac (or the Font Viewer on your Windows PC).

2. Select the font file you downloaded and click “Install Font” (on Mac) or “Install” (on Windows).

3. Once installed, the font should be available in your font menu for use in your design applications.
